Buying a Home in Buffalo, New York
Buffalo is one of the Northeast's growing metro areas with a population of 277,000. The median home price of $205,000 makes it one of the more affordable major metros.
With average rent at $1,420/month, a renter in Buffalo investing $500/month into diversified REITs could accumulate a 20% down payment of $41,000 in approximately 5.5 years. The same monthly contribution in a traditional savings account would take about 6.8 years.
Home prices in Buffalo have grown 30% over the past five years, outpacing the national average. For renters, this means the down payment target continues to move, making it even more important to invest rather than just save, so your money grows alongside home prices.
